MGM Resorts International (MGM) rallied $0.74 or 1.96% to close at $38.40, reversing recent weakness as the casino and resort operator benefited from improved sector sentiment. The stock is currently trading above its near-term support of $36.48 and faces overhead resistance near $40.32.

MGM's +1.96% gain on Thursday came on above-average trading volume, suggesting renewed buyer interest after a period of consolidation. The broader casino and gaming sector saw a modest uptick, with several regional operators also posting gains. While no single catalyst drove the move, market participants pointed to a slight easing in recession fears and resilient consumer spending data as potential tailwinds. MGM’s recovery from an intraday low of $37.85 indicates that buyers stepped in near the stock’s 50-day moving average, a level that has historically attracted support. The company’s strong presence in Las Vegas and Macau continues to provide a dual-revenue stream, though macroeconomic headwinds—such as higher interest rates and slowing Chinese tourism—remain in focus. Short-term traders are closely watching whether MGM can build on this momentum and reclaim the $40 level, which would represent a breakout from its recent trading range. The current price of $38.40 is still well below the stock’s 52-week high, highlighting the broader downtrend that began earlier this year.

From a technical perspective, MGM is testing the mid-point of its current trading band. The stock has established clear support at $36.48, a level that has held firm during the past two pullbacks. Above, resistance at $40.32 has capped rallies in recent weeks and represents a critical hurdle for bulls. The relative strength index (RSI) has moved into neutral territory, likely in the low- to mid-50s, suggesting that the stock is neither overbought nor oversold after the latest bounce. The moving average convergence divergence (MACD) indicator may be showing early signs of a bullish crossover, though confirmation is needed. Volume patterns indicate accumulation on up days, with Thursday’s above-average turnover adding credibility to the move. The stock remains below its 200-day moving average, which is a longer-term bearish signal, but the recent bounce from the support zone provides a potential base for a recovery. A sustained break above $40.32 could open the path toward the $42 area, while a failure to hold $36.48 might lead to a retest of the $35 region.

Looking ahead, MGM’s near-term trajectory may be influenced by several factors. The company’s upcoming quarterly results, expected in the coming weeks, could provide clarity on Las Vegas Strip trends and Macau recovery progress. If MGM reports operating metrics that exceed modest expectations, the stock could challenge resistance at $40.32 and potentially move higher. Conversely, any signs of softening consumer spending or disappointing Macau visitation numbers might cause the stock to retreat toward the $36.48 support level. The broader market environment also matters: a risk-on shift in equities could boost casino stocks, while a renewed selloff in growth names may weigh on MGM. Traders should watch for volume confirmation on any breakout above resistance. A move above $40.32 with strong volume could signal a trend reversal, while a low-volume break might prove false. The stock remains range-bound for now, and a clear directional move may require a catalyst such as earnings or a change in macroeconomic data.
